大学生实战MySQL:从零打造数据库项目案例

资源类型:qilanfushi.com 2025-07-24 00:33

大学生mysql项目实战案例简介:



大学生MySQL项目实战案例:塑造数据管理能力,引领技术创新 在当今数字化时代,数据已成为驱动各行各业发展的关键要素

    对于大学生而言,掌握数据处理与分析技能不仅是提升个人竞争力的关键,更是未来职业生涯中不可或缺的一部分

    MySQL作为一种广泛应用的开源关系型数据库管理系统,以其高性能、可靠性和易用性,成为了大学生学习和实践数据库技术的首选平台

    本文将通过几个具体的大学生MySQL项目实战案例,展示如何通过实践深化理论知识,提升数据管理能力,进而引领技术创新

     案例一:校园二手书交易平台数据管理系统 项目背景: 随着环保意识的增强和资源共享理念的普及,校园二手书交易日益受到学生的欢迎

    然而,传统的线下交易方式存在信息不对称、交易效率低等问题

    因此,开发一个校园二手书交易平台,利用MySQL数据库进行数据管理,成为解决这些问题的有效途径

     技术方案: 1.数据库设计:首先,团队设计了包含用户信息表、书籍信息表、交易记录表等多个表的数据库结构,确保数据的完整性和一致性

    通过合理设置主键、外键约束,有效防止数据冗余和错误

     2.数据录入与查询优化:为了提高数据录入效率和查询速度,团队采用了批量插入、索引优化等技术手段

    同时,利用MySQL的视图功能,为用户提供了直观的书籍分类浏览和搜索功能

     3.并发控制:考虑到平台用户可能同时访问和修改数据,团队实施了事务管理和锁机制,确保数据的一致性和安全性

     成果展示: 该平台上线后,不仅极大地促进了校园内的二手书流通,还通过数据分析为平台运营提供了有力支持

    例如,通过分析用户浏览和购买记录,平台能够精准推送用户感兴趣的书籍信息,提升用户体验和交易量

     启示: 此项目让大学生深刻体会到数据库设计在解决实际问题中的重要性,同时也锻炼了他们的数据建模、优化查询和并发控制能力,为未来从事大数据处理、云计算等领域的工作打下了坚实基础

     案例二:基于MySQL的学生成绩管理系统 项目背景: 传统的学生成绩管理方式往往依赖于纸质记录或简单的电子表格,这种方式不仅效率低下,且易于出错

    为了提升教学管理效率,开发一个基于MySQL的学生成绩管理系统显得尤为重要

     技术方案: 1.数据模型设计:系统设计了学生信息表、课程信息表、成绩信息表等核心表结构,通过关联查询实现学生成绩的综合展示

     2.数据安全性:为了确保学生成绩等敏感信息的安全,团队采用了密码加密存储、权限管理等安全措施

    同时,通过定期备份数据库,防止数据丢失

     3.报表生成:利用MySQL的报告生成功能,系统能够自动生成各类成绩统计报表,如班级平均分、学生个人成绩趋势图等,为教师和教务管理人员提供了便捷的数据分析工具

     成果展示: 该系统成功应用于某高校的教学管理中,显著提高了成绩管理的准确性和效率

    教师和教务人员可以通过系统快速获取所需数据,为教学评估、奖学金评定等工作提供了有力支持

     启示: 此项目不仅让大学生掌握了数据库安全管理和报表生成等高级技能,更重要的是,通过实际应用,他们学会了如何将数据库技术服务于教育领域的实际需求,体现了技术的社会价值

     案例三:基于MySQL的电商物流追踪系统 项目背景: 随着电子商务的蓬勃发展,物流追踪成为提升用户体验的关键环节

    一个高效、准确的物流追踪系统,能够帮助用户实时了解包裹状态,减少焦虑,提升满意度

     技术方案: 1.数据库设计:系统设计了订单信息表、物流节点信息表、用户信息表等,通过复杂关联查询实现物流信息的实时追踪

     2.数据同步与更新:为了确保物流信息的实时性,团队采用了消息队列和定时任务相结合的方式,实现数据库与外部物流接口的数据同步

     3.数据可视化:利用MySQL与前端技术的结合,系统提供了物流轨迹地图展示、预计到达时间提醒等功能,增强了用户体验

     成果展示: 该系统上线后,用户反馈良好,物流追踪准确率显著提高,有效降低了因信息不对称导致的用户投诉

    同时,通过数据分析,电商企业还能够优化物流路线,降低成本

     启示: 此项目不仅考验了大学生的数据库设计与优化能力,更重要的是,它展示了如何将数据库技术与前端技术、外部API集成,构建出具有实际应用价值的复杂系统

    这一过程不仅提升了学生的技术栈深度,也培养了他们的跨领域协作和问题解决能力

     结语 通过上述三个大学生MySQL项目实战案例,我们可以看到,数据库技术不仅是计算机科学领域的基础,更是连接理论与实践、技术与应用的桥梁

    大学生通过参与这些项目,不仅能够深入理解MySQL的核心概念和高级功能,更重要的是,他们能够在实践中学习如何运用技术解决实际问题,培养创新思维和团队协作能力

     未来,随着大数据、人工智能等技术的不断发展,数据库技术将持续迭代升级,为各行各业提供更强大的数据支持

    因此,对于当代大学生而言,抓住机遇,深入学习并实践数据库技术,将是通往成功职业生涯的重要一步

    让我们期待更多的大学生能够在MySQL项目实战中绽放光彩,用技术点亮未来

    

阅读全文
上一篇:iBatis MySQL高效分页技巧揭秘

最新收录:

  • MySQL安装路径修改指南:轻松变更存储位置
  • iBatis MySQL高效分页技巧揭秘
  • MySQL直接常量运用技巧:提升数据库操作效率
  • MySQL中如何高效创建与使用临时表?
  • MySQL8.0.11全新连接方式解析与实战指南
  • MySQL加法运算结果含小数处理技巧
  • 关系型数据库基础与MySQL实战简述
  • MySQL用户并发登录解决方案
  • 如何让MySQL完美支持Emoji表情
  • MySQL查询技巧:获取索引数组详解
  • MySQL数据库:轻松备份单个表单的实用指南
  • 解决MySQL迁移中的乱码问题全攻略
  • 首页 | 大学生mysql项目实战案例:大学生实战MySQL:从零打造数据库项目案例